Role Overview

An Associate Field Service Tech (AFST) is responsible for performing hands-on installation, commissioning, and service on products serviced by Fairbanks Morse Defense. The AFST shall maintain a professional and positive attitude, perform quality workmanship, and be responsive to customer needs.

What You Will Do

Perform hands-on installation, commissioning, and service on products serviced by Fairbanks Morse Defense, including diesel engines, electrical controls, roll-up doors, cranes, elevators, and davits.
